Nitrosyl Triflate and Nitrous Anhydride, Same Mode of Generation, but Very Different Reaction Pathways. Direct Synthesis of 1,2-Oxazetes, Nitroso or Bisoxazo Compounds from Olefins.

Abstract: Nitrosyl triflate (TfONO) can be generated in situ from tetra-n-butylammonium nitrite and triflic anhydride (1:1) in CH2Cl2 solution at ca. -30 °C. It acts as a powerful and soluble nitrosating agent with a wide range… read more here.

Mechanism of the Reaction of Olefins with Nitrous Anhydride (O═N-O-N═O) to Form 1,2-Oxazetes.

Abstract: The mechanistic pathway for the formation of 1,2-oxazetes by reaction of olefins with nitrous anhydride has been clarified. The initial reaction intermediate, a β-nitroso nitrite ester that is sensitive to light, undergoes O-NO fission to… read more here.
